Brasstown Bald, Amicalola Falls, and Helen, Georgia are all located in what region?
Maru [420]

Answer: Blue Ridge region.

The Brasstown Bald, Amicalola Falls, and Helen, Georgia are all located in the Blue Ridge region.

The Brasstown Bald, the highest point in state is located in northeast Georgia.  At the southern end is the  Amicalola Falls (tallest waterfall east of the Mississippi).  Helen is also located in the Blue Ridge region.

The Causes of the French Revolution of 1848. <span>Some of the causes of the French Revolution was the severe economic problems beginning in 1846 brought untold hardship in France to the lower-middle class, workers, and peasants. Also, many members of the middle class wanted the right to vote. The government of the then king of France, Louis Philippe, refused to make changes, and opposition grew. The monarchy was finally overthrown in 1848. The new constitution ratified on November 4, 1848, and set up a republic called the Second Republic.</span>
